I was on here looking at the posts when I came up with some ideas they might be able to put in the game.
 
1) If you are bleeding, you should walk slower and/or feel dizzy.  If you are losing a lot of blood, it would be a cool idea to slowly lose life until you get it healed.
2)Get married and have kids.  When your kids grow up and get married and have kids, it would be neat to make a family name that can be passed on like this.
3)Pets.  There should be many different kinds of pets you can buy.  If you treat your pet badly, it will die fast.  You can train it to do things-go get something for you, attack a person.
4)Stars and planets.  There should be stars and planets that people can name.  There should also be comets.

Quote
1) If you are bleeding, you should walk slower and/or feel dizzy. If you are losing a lot of blood, it would be a cool idea to slowly lose life until you get it healed.


This is how I think it should work:
You only lose HP when wounded after one of the following events happen...a) You get poisoned or infected (When, for example, a snake bites you, or you are hit by a poisoned weapon)
b) You are hit in a vital part (chest and head),  because I guess that a fighter would be able to keep fighting if he is cut or hit in an arm. This would also depend on how effective the hit was, a slight cut won\'t give you any trouble,  but a critical hit could seriously put your life in danger.
